Summary
Installs, maintains and repairs water, sewer, steam, and gas systems. Performs inspections, testing and preventative maintenance of water, sewer, fire suppression, steam and gas systems. Provides general facility maintenance.
Job Duties
- Analyzes blueprints and specifications in order to understand the existing building's layout of pipes, drainage systems, and other plumbing systems.
- Provides maintenance and repair of piping, valves, fixtures, drainage systems, steam, and gas systems.
- Performs inspections, testing and preventative maintenance of water, sewer, fire suppression, steam and gas systems, ensuring compliance with state, local codes and Joint Commission standards.
- Responds to trouble calls, work requests and emergency situations.
- Performs minor maintenance of electrical, mechanical equipment, HVAC, systems, structures and other general maintenance.
- Assists department colleagues of all trades.
- Utilizes the CMMS work order system and documents time and work completed, all in a timely manner.
- Maintains inventory and acquires parts as needed to perform repairs.
Minimum Qualifications
- High School Diploma/GED with required years of experience or Technical School Diploma in Plumbing or related trade
- 3 years experience as a plumber in commercial or industrial setting or less than 1 year with Technical School Diploma
- Ability to read drawings and figures to understand the layout of water supply, waste, and venting systems.
- Excellent communication skills both written and verbal.
- Demonstrated mechanical aptitude.
- Skill in using hand and power tools and machines to measure, cut, bend, and thread pipes.
- Skill in using logic and reasoning to identify the strengths and weaknesses of alternative solutions, conclusions or approaches to problems.
Physical Demands
Lift over 50 lbs. Push/pull up to 140 lbs. Carry 80 lbs. short distances. Frequent standing/walking, squatting, kneeling, crawling, climbing and reaching overhead.

What Pennsylvania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in plumber jobs across Pennsylvania.
- Valid state journeyman or master plumber license in the hiring state
- Hands-on experience with residential and commercial pipe installation and repair
- Proficiency with copper, PEX, PVC, and cast iron piping systems
- OSHA-10 or OSHA-30 safety certification preferred or required
- Ability to read and interpret blueprints and mechanical drawings
- Valid driver's license and reliable transportation to job sites

How much do plumbers make in Pennsylvania?
Plumbers in Pennsylvania earn a median of about $68,080 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$46,770 for the lowest 10% to over $134,110 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.
